Best of all, it shows how to do it ... ramp bartending certificationWebFeb 10, 2015 · If you have trouble making the plane fly an approach, try this: Tune the frequency from the FSX map manually in your NAV1 (not 2). Fly an intercepting angle (+- 45 degrees of the localizer (LLZ)) and hit APR on your autopilot a few NM before intercept and see if it catches. When ATC says "maintain [altitude] until established," you are established when you are on a lateral segment of the approach.
